| Rank | Name | Time | ||
|---|---|---|---|---|
| 1 | Sergi Mestre | 15.0 km/h | - | 1:42 |
| 2 | Eric Castello Garcia | 14.8 km/h | 420 W | 1:43 |
| 3 | Raul Valles | 14.5 km/h | 412 W | 1:45 |
| 4 | Toni V | 14.4 km/h | - | 1:46 |
| 5 | Sergi O | 14.3 km/h | - | 1:47 |
| 6 | Josep Termens Nadal | 14.0 km/h | 284 W | 1:49 |
| 6 | Bernat Cañellas | 14.0 km/h | - | 1:49 |
| 8 | Aleix L | 13.7 km/h | 315 W | 1:51 |
| 8 | Melcior F | 13.7 km/h | 354 W | 1:51 |
| 10 | David Farré | 13.6 km/h | 347 W | 1:52 |
| 10 | Josep Enric F | 13.6 km/h | 371 W | 1:52 |
| 10 | Joe Brew | 13.6 km/h | 410 W | 1:52 |
Join Strava to see the full leaderboard